Job Description:
We are seeking a skilled CT Technologist to join our team on a travel assignment basis. As a member of our team, you will work closely with patients, medical staff, and other healthcare professionals to ensure high-quality care and patient satisfaction. Your primary responsibilities will include operating computed tomography scanners, performing diagnostic tests, and maintaining accurate records.
Required Skills and Qualifications:
To be successful in this role, you must possess current certifications in radiography and CPR/BLS, as well as a state license to practice as a radiology technologist in Nebraska. Additionally, you should have excellent communication and interpersonal skills, ability to work in a fast-paced environment, and commitment to delivering exceptional patient care.
